From March 29 through April 1, Student Council attended the Texas Association of Student Councils conference in San Antonio. During the conference, student leaders participated in workshops and activities that focused on personal growth, teamwork, and leadership skills. They learned important life lessons like communication and responsibility while also collaborating with others and sharing ideas. The event also gave them the opportunity to network with student councils from different schools and gain new perspectives, making the experience both educational and inspiring.
